How much do design assistant project man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 21, 2026, the average yearly pay for design assistant project manager in Suffolk, VA is $69,505.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$50,900.00 and $83,700.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a design assistant project manager do?

A Design Assistant Project Manager supports the project manager and design team in coordinating and executing design projects. Their responsibilities typically include assisting with project planning, scheduling meetings, tracking project progress, preparing documentation, and helping to ensure that design deliverables meet client requirements and deadlines. They often serve as a liaison between designers, clients, and contractors, helping to communicate updates and resolve issues as they arise. This role requires strong organizational, communication, and problem-solving skills.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a design assistant project manager?

To thrive as a Design Assistant Project Manager, you need a background in architecture, engineering, or construction management, along with strong organizational and project coordination skills. Familiarity with design software like AutoCAD, Revit, and project management tools such as MS Project or Primavera is typically required. Attention to detail, proactive communication, and problem-solving abilities are vital soft skills for supporting project delivery and managing stakeholder expectations. These competencies ensure efficient workflow, effective collaboration, and successful execution of design projects.

What is the difference between Design Assistant Project Manager vs Interior Designer?

AspectDesign Assistant Project ManagerInterior Designer
CredentialsBachelor's in design, architecture, or related field; certifications like PMP are a plusDegree in interior design or architecture; NCIDQ certification often preferred
Work EnvironmentCollaborates with project teams, manages schedules, and oversees project executionFocuses on space planning, aesthetics, and client consultations
Industry UsageUsed in architecture, construction, and design firms for project coordinationPrimarily in interior design firms, showrooms, and independent practices

The main difference is that a Design Assistant Project Manager focuses on coordinating and managing project timelines and teams, while an Interior Designer concentrates on creating functional and aesthetic interior spaces. Both roles require design knowledge and collaboration but differ in scope and responsibilities.

Requirements:

The Assistant Project Manager (APM) supports the Project Manager in day-to-day contract execution, serves as the designated PM backup during absences or unavailability, and independently owns specific operational workstreams including regulatory reporting, Joint Operating Agreement (JOA) coordination with Medicare Administrative Contractors (MACs), meeting management, and compliance tracking.


Essential Duties and Responsibilities

  • Support the Project Manager in all aspects of day-to-day contract execution; serve as the designated PM backup and assume full PM responsibilities during absences or unavailability without interruption to program operations or CMS deliverables.
  • Own the regulatory reporting workstream end-to-end, including the preparation, review, quality control, and on-time submission of all required CMS reports, monthly status updates, and contractual deliverables.
  • Lead coordination of Joint Operating Agreements (JOAs) with Medicare Administrative Contractors (MACs), including scheduling, agenda development, documentation, follow-up action tracking, and compliance with CMS JOA requirements.
  • Manage the program meeting structure, including CMS status calls, internal leadership meetings, and cross-functional operational reviews; prepare agendas, capture minutes, and track decisions and action items to resolution.
  • Own compliance tracking across program workstreams, maintaining visibility into contractual performance standards, deliverable deadlines, corrective action plans, and COR/CO correspondence; escalate issues to the PM with recommended courses of action.
  • Manage complex systems and medical review workflow operations, ensuring staffing levels, review throughput, and operational processes remain aligned with contractual performance standards and CMS expectations.
  • Interface with CMS on day-to-day operational matters within the APM’s assigned workstreams; maintain professional, responsive relationships with the Contracting Officer Representative (COR) and Contracting Officer (CO) as directed by the PM.
  • Support contract transition activities, onboarding of new personnel, and special projects as assigned by the PM; contribute to continuous improvement initiatives across program operations.

Qualifications

  • Minimum 4 years of professional experience in healthcare program management, federal contracting, or a closely related operational field.
  • Minimum 3 years of experience managing complex systems and medical review workflow operations, including demonstrated ability to track performance across multiple concurrent workstreams.
  • Minimum 2 years of experience in Medicare Fee-for-Service (FFS) program operations, with working knowledge of Medicare coverage, payment policy, and claims processing.
  • Master’s degree in Healthcare Administration, Public Administration, Business Administration, or a related field preferred. In lieu of a Master’s degree, a Bachelor’s degree plus a minimum of 3 additional years of directly relevant experience may be substituted.

Preferred Qualifications

  • Prior experience as an operations manager, deputy director, or senior program administrator at a CMS medical review contractor.
  • Working knowledge of federal contracting reporting requirements, Contracting Officer Representative (COR) and Contracting Officer (CO) relationship dynamics, and monthly status reporting cycles in a CMS contract environment.
  • Direct experience coordinating Joint Operating Agreements (JOAs) with Medicare Administrative Contractors (MACs), including an understanding of data sharing protocols, referral workflows, and contractor coordination obligations under CMS policy.
